Product details
Overview
74AHC2G32DP,125 from Nexperia is a dual 2-input OR gate logic IC in TSSOP8 package, operating from 2.0 V to 5.5 V supply, with overvoltage-tolerant inputs up to 5.5 V, CMOS input levels, and guaranteed operation from –40 °C to +125 °C - used for level translation and combinatorial logic in mixed-voltage digital interfaces.
For engineers reviewing the 74AHC2G32DP,125 datasheet, 74AHC2G32DP,125 pinout, 74AHC2G32DP,125 application, or 74AHC2G32DP,125 equivalent, this device supports voltage-level bridging between 3.3 V and 5 V domains, delivers symmetrical output drive (±8 mA), and maintains low propagation delay (3.2 ns typical at 5 V/15 pF) with high noise immunity in space-constrained industrial control and sensor interface designs.
Technical Context
The 74AHC2G32DP,125 implements two independent OR gates with true TTL-compatible output characteristics and CMOS input thresholds. Its overvoltage-tolerant inputs enable direct connection to 5.5 V signals while powered from as low as 2.0 V, eliminating external level-shifting components.
It features balanced rise/fall times, latch-up immunity exceeding 100 mA per JESD78 Class II Level A, and ESD protection rated at >2000 V HBM and >1000 V CDM - ensuring robustness in noisy industrial environments and hot-swap-capable subsystems.
Key Specifications
| Parameter | Value and Actual Design Meaning |
|---|---|
| Supply Voltage Range | 2.0 V to 5.5 V - enables single-supply operation across 2.5 V, 3.3 V, and 5 V logic domains without level shifters. |
| Input Voltage Tolerance | Up to 5.5 V independent of VCC - allows safe interfacing with higher-voltage peripherals while powered at lower rail. |
| Propagation Delay (tpd) | 3.2 ns typical at VCC = 5.0 V, CL = 15 pF - ensures tight timing margins in high-speed control path logic. |
| Output Drive Strength | ±8.0 mA at VCC = 4.5 V - provides sufficient current to drive multiple CMOS loads or moderate PCB trace capacitance. |
| Operating Temperature | –40 °C to +125 °C - qualified for under-hood automotive modules, industrial PLC I/O, and extended-temperature embedded systems. |
| Power Dissipation | 250 mW maximum at Tamb ≤ 96 °C (TSSOP8) - supports continuous operation in thermally constrained PCB layouts. |
| Input Capacitance (CI) | 10 pF max - minimizes loading on upstream drivers and preserves signal integrity in fan-out-critical nodes. |
Pinout & Package
TSSOP8 plastic thin shrink small outline package (SOT505-2); 8 leads; body width 3 mm; lead length 0.5 mm; pin 1 index located below marking code in lower-left corner.
| Pin/Terminal | Circuit Role | Design Meaning |
|---|---|---|
| 1 | 1A | First OR gate input A - accepts overvoltage-tolerant logic signals up to 5.5 V. |
| 2 | 1B | First OR gate input B - electrically identical to 1A; enables dual-input OR function for primary logic path. |
| 3 | 2Y | Second OR gate output Y - drives downstream logic with symmetrical VOH/VOL and ±8 mA capability. |
| 4 | GND | Ground reference - common return path for all internal circuitry and output current sinks. |
| 5 | 2A | Second OR gate input A - independent of first gate; supports parallel logic evaluation. |
| 6 | 2B | Second OR gate input B - matches 1B functionality; enables compact dual-gate implementation. |
| 7 | 1Y | First OR gate output Y - provides dedicated output for first gate with identical drive specs as 2Y. |
| 8 | VCC | Positive supply - powers both gates; decoupling capacitor required within 10 mm for stable switching. |
Key Features
| Feature | Design Value |
|---|---|
| Overvoltage-tolerant inputs | Withstand 5.5 V regardless of VCC (2.0–5.5 V), enabling reliable level translation without external components. |
| Symmetrical output impedance | Matched pull-up/pull-down strength ensures consistent rise/fall times and reduces timing skew in critical paths. |
| High noise immunity | VIH = 3.85 V and VIL = 1.65 V at VCC = 5.5 V - provides >1.3 V noise margin against EMI in industrial environments. |
| Low dynamic power | CPD = 16 pF per buffer - limits switching power to <1 μW/MHz at 3.3 V, supporting battery-sensitive applications. |
| Latch-up immunity | Exceeds 100 mA per JESD78 Class II Level A - prevents destructive latch-up during transient overcurrent events. |

Equivalent & Alternatives
The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ar dual 2-input OR gate applications.
| Alternative Part | Technical Difference | Application Difference | Selection Advice |
|---|---|---|---|
| 74AHCT2G32DP,125 | TTL-compatible input thresholds (VIH = 2.0 V min at VCC = 4.5–5.5 V) vs. CMOS thresholds in AHC version. | Better compatibility with legacy 5 V TTL outputs; less suitable for sub-3 V logic interfacing. | Select when interfacing with standard TTL sources; avoid if driving from low-voltage CMOS or battery-powered controllers. |
| SN74LVC2G32DCUR | Nominal 1.65–5.5 V supply range; slightly higher ICC (max 10 μA vs. 40 μA at 125 °C); same TSSOP8 footprint. | Lower static power at room temperature; tighter VOL spec (0.55 V max at 8 mA) improves noise margin in 3.3 V systems. | Prefer for ultra-low-quiescent-power designs or where tighter VOL is required; verify layout compatibility with thermal pad. |
Compared with 74AHC2G32DP,125, the AHCT variant offers superior TTL input compatibility but reduced low-voltage flexibility, while the LVC variant delivers lower static current and improved VOL at the cost of marginally higher dynamic power and different ESD ratings.

FAQ
Is the 74AHC2G32DP,125 pin-compatible with the 74AHCT2G32DP,125?
Yes - both share identical TSSOP8 (SOT505-2) pinout and mechanical footprint. However, input threshold behavior differs: the AHC version uses CMOS-compatible VIH/VIL (e.g., VIH = 3.85 V at VCC = 5.5 V), while the AHCT version uses TTL-compatible thresholds (VIH = 2.0 V min). Swapping requires verification of upstream driver compatibility.
What is the maximum capacitive load the 74AHC2G32DP,125 can drive reliably?
The device is characterized up to 50 pF load capacitance per output, with propagation delay specified at 15 pF and 50 pF. Driving >50 pF may increase tpd beyond datasheet limits and degrade edge rates; for heavier loads, add series termination or buffer stages. Output current remains within ±8 mA limits up to CL = 100 pF under recommended conditions.
Does the 74AHC2G32DP,125 require external pull-up or pull-down resistors on unused inputs?
No - unused inputs must be tied to VCC or GND to prevent floating states and excessive ICC. The device has no internal pull resistors. Leaving inputs unconnected risks increased power consumption, oscillation, and ESD susceptibility due to undefined input voltage.
Can the 74AHC2G32DP,125 operate at 1.8 V supply?
No - the absolute minimum supply voltage is 2.0 V per datasheet Section 9. Operation below 2.0 V is not characterized or guaranteed; VIH/VIL thresholds become undefined, and output drive collapses. For 1.8 V systems, consider the SN74LVC2G32 or 74LVC2G32 families instead.
